Philosophy of Biological Science

The Philosophy of Biological Science examines the fundamental principles, concepts, and assumptions underlying the scientific study of living organisms. It explores the nature of biological phenomena, the methods used to investigate them, and the implications of biological research for our understanding of the natural world. This field delves into topics such as the nature of life, the relationship between living organisms and their environment, the role of evolution in shaping biological diversity, and the ethical implications of advances in biotechnology. Philosophers of biological science analyze the epistemological and metaphysical foundations of biology, as well as the ethical and social implications of biological research and its applications.
